                        GAZA, June 29 (Reuters) - Parts of southern Gaza were plunged into darkness on Thursday when a rocket apparently fired by Palestinian militants went off course and hit a power sub-station, witnesses said.

                        Israel's army said it was not involved in any attacks in the area at the time of the incident. Earlier, witnesses said Israeli missiles had knocked out the power source.

                        Israeli air strikes badly damaged Gaza's main power transformers in the centre of the strip on Wednesday as part of an offensive to force Palestinian militants to free an abducted soldier.
